Linksys WRH54G Denial of Service Vulnerability
Secunia Advisory: SA30562
Release Date: 2008-06-10
Last Update: 2008-06-12
Popularity: 2,523 views

Critical:
Less critical
Impact: DoS
Where: From local network
Solution Status: Vendor Patch

OS:Linksys WRH54G

Subscribe: Instant alerts on relevant vulnerabilities

CVE reference:CVE-2008-2636


Description:
A vulnerability has been reported in Linksys WRH54G, which can be exploited by malicious people to cause a DoS (Denial of Service).

The vulnerability is caused due to an error when processing HTTP requests. This can be exploited to disable the HTTP service by sending a specially crafted HTTP request to an affected device.

The vulnerability is reported in firmware version 1.01.03. Prior versions may also be affected.

Solution:
Update to firmware version 1.01.04.
